Mobile mapping is the procedure of collecting geospatial data by using a mobile automobile outfitted with a laser, GNSS, LiDAR-system, radar, photo tool, or any number of remote sensing devices. A mobile mapping study is the data collection process that is utilized to establish the positions of factors on the surface of the Earth and compute the angles and ranges in between them.

With mobile mapping systems, terabytes of high resolution and precision data can be accumulated quickly. The restrictions of mobile mapping include budgetary worries, misunderstandings regarding precision, roi, and the top quality of deliverables.
